Subject: Nightly search reindex — heads up

Hi support folks,

Quick note: the nightly reindex for Lanternfind kicks off at 02:00 and should wrap by 04:30. During that window, brand-new documents may lag in search results by a few minutes — totally expected, no tickets needed. If customers report missing results after 05:00, escalate to the search rotation. The build token for tonight's reindex run is right below.

session token of taduf-tahog = htk4_91a1

**Q: How does Rovano assign drivers to jobs?**

A: The matcher scores each available driver on distance, shift time remaining, and vehicle class. Highest score wins; ties break on idle time. Do not override assignments manually unless dispatch approves. Scores refresh every 40 seconds, so a rejected job re-enters the pool fast. Full scoring weights are documented on the internal wiki page below.

runbook for tajep-yahig: https://artifactory.lumictech.corp/repo

- [ ] Load test Cartwheel checkout flow. Run the standard 3x peak profile against staging for 30 minutes. Pass criteria: p95 under 800ms, zero payment-step errors, no queue backlog after drain. Capture the report and attach to the release ticket. Do not sign off on a partial run — a truncated test masked the cart-merge bug last cycle. Record results against the candidate build identified by the token below.

pipeline stamp: htk31_f769b577b3028a4e9958e5bb8d1259a